My win XP seems to be doing something I have no clue
about. For no apparent reason, the CPU suddenly gets
eaten up (100% or close) and I can no longer run (or even
start) most programs. This includes such things as
opening the task manager; I just get an error message when
I try ctrl-alt-del! This is not an old system, Pentium 3,
has plenty of RAM and hard disk space, the processes that
are eating up the CPU aren't always the same (dumprep
comes up a lot).
I have never had this problem with any other system or
version of Windows! What can I do?
